As the Banquet Cook at Edgewood Country Club, you will be responsible for:
Preparing large quantities of soups, stocks, sauces, meats, seafood, vegetables, and other items efficiently for special function purposes (such as menu tastings and other banquets and catering events)
Meticulously following standard recipes and client specifications during food preparation, ensuring portion control, quality, and accommodating special dietary requirements as outlined in banquet menus
Coordinating dish preparation timing to ensure all food is served hot and at the same time, while arranging dishes with meticulous attention to detail and aesthetic appeal, including thoughtful garnishing
Assist the kitchen team with preparing 'mise en place,' buffet platters and banquet presentation displays, ensuring all setups for parties and functions are completed in a timely manner
Collaborating with kitchen staff, front-of-house management and servers to ensure smooth, efficient service and an exceptional event experience
Following all kitchen preparation and closing procedures meticulously to ensure efficient operation and maintain cleanliness standards
Ensuring daily wrapping, dating and replenishment of all food items stored in designated areas
Using food preparation equipment according to manufacturers’ instructions
Maintaining cleanliness of the work station, kitchen equipment and other areas (such as storerooms and walk-ins)
Ensuring compliance with all local health codes and HACCP procedures, maintaining proper organization, temperatures and cleanliness standards
Assisting with the preparation of other food products on the serving line as needed
